Full entry

development /dÇ'velǝpmǝnt/ n

၁။ [U] ကြီးထွားရင့်သန်မှု။ ဖွံ့ဖြိုးမှု။ တည်ဆောက်ပြုပြင်မှု။
the healthy development of children ❍ encourage the development of small businesses ❍ land that is ripe for development (ie ready to be built on).
၂။ [C] (က) အသစ်တိုးတက်ဖြစ်ပေါ်မှု။
the latest development in the continuing crisis ❍ We must await further developments.
(ခ) တီထွင်မှု။ တိုးတက်မှု။
Our electrically-powered car is an exciting new development.
၃။ [C] အဆောက်အအုံသစ်များဖြင့် စည်ပင်တိုးတက် နေသော နယ်မြေ။
a commercial development on the outskirts of the town.
❏ developmental /dÇvelǝp'mentl/ adj
၁။ ဖွံ့ဖြိုးဆဲ ဖြစ် သော။
a product at a developmental stage.
၂။ ဖွံ့ဖြိုးမှုနှင့် ဆိုင်သော။
developmental psychology.
❏ development area n (Brit ) ဖွံ့ဖြိုးအောင် ပျိုးထောင်ဆဲ ဒေသ။
